#420cf7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#420cf7 is composed of 25.9% red, 4.7%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 253.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 50.8%. #420cf7 color hex could be obtained by blending #8418ff with #0000ef.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#420cf7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f3f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#420cf7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818083 is the less saturated color, while #420cf7 is the most saturated one.
